The lyrics of Junior Parker's song 'Mystery Train' depict a journey on a long train that is carrying the singer's love interest. The train is described as being sixteen coaches long, which is a clear indication of its size and power. The repetition of the phrase 'train, train, comin' 'round the bend' creates a sense of anticipation and drama, as if the singer is waiting for something significant to happen. The lyrics suggest that the train has taken the singer's lover away, but also alludes to the fact that she will return again. There is a sense of sadness in the lyrics, but also a glimmer of hope.
